Key Features of the Asus ROG Strix Scar 18

The Scar 18 boasts cutting-edge hardware with the latest Intel and Nvidia tech. The version I’m discussing is equipped with the top-tier Nvidia GeForce RTX 5090 GPU, making it a formidable contender in gaming performance. Here’s a closer look at its highlights:

  • Robust Build Quality: The Scar 18 feels solid and reliable, with a design that impresses.
  • User-Friendly Upgrades: Thanks to Asus’s thoughtful design, accessing the internals for upgrades is a breeze—no tools required.
  • Impressive Connectivity: It includes multiple Thunderbolt 5 ports and USB Type-A ports for all your accessories.

Does the Display Stand Out?

Yes! The 18-inch Nebula HDR display with a resolution of 2560 x 1660 and a remarkable 240Hz refresh rate sets the standard for gaming laptops. The color accuracy is impressive, with 100% sRGB and a contrast ratio of 16,310:1. This guarantees stunning visuals during sessions of your favorite games.

How Does It Perform Under Pressure?

Equipped with an Intel Core Ultra 9 275HX processor and exceptional cooling solutions, the Scar 18 performs admirably. During gaming sessions, the temperature remains manageable, and even under demanding tasks, it holds up remarkably well. Such high performance is supported by effective thermals, ensuring that long gaming sessions remain comfortable.

How Noisy Is It During Operations?

For those concerned about noise levels, the Scar 18 delivers a relatively quiet performance. In silent mode, the noise is minimal, topping around 35 dB, while it maxes out at 56 dB in Turbo mode. It’s not overly obtrusive, allowing for an immersive gaming experience.

Is There an Optimal Power Mode for Gaming?

The Scar 18 offers tailored power modes, including Silent, Performance, and Turbo, along with a Manual mode for fine-tuning your setup. This lets you regulate performance to balance power consumption and thermal management based on your needs.

What Are the Downsides?

No device is perfect. While the Scar 18 excels in many areas, the webcam quality is underwhelming, especially given its premium price. Also, the placement of ports makes cable management a bit cluttered. These factors could be dealbreakers for some gamers.
